The v4.2 release resolves the N+1 query pattern in the Ombrelle GraphQL resolver layer by batching nested lookups through a dataloader tier. Release managers should verify batching via the query-metrics endpoint before promoting builds. That endpoint requires authentication against the internal metrics service, using the key below.

gateway credential: kto3_qfe

## Bulk Edits in the Wrenfield Admin Table

Bulk edits let you change status, owner, or tier on up to 500 rows at once. Always filter before selecting: the select-all checkbox applies to the filtered set, not just the visible page, which has surprised people. Edits are queued, not instant, so refresh after a minute before assuming failure. There is no bulk undo — mistakes must be reversed row by row, so double-check the preview dialog. The full step-by-step guide with screenshots is maintained internally here.

operations page: https://jenkins.zemvarcloud.local/job/merge_requests/repo/build/73930b4b30f0a8ed

Mail room relocation — effective Monday. The Kestrel Building mail room has moved from the basement to level 1, beside the goods entrance. All parcels now collected there; basement counter is closed. Outgoing post cut-off remains 15:30. Do not prop the level 1 door — it alarms after 60 seconds. Collections require sign-off in the ledger by the counter. New starters need the door-pass code for the level 1 mail room, shown below.

badge for yajep-tawip: bdg-UBYAH-39947

## Deployment

The Frostvault archiver moves cold storage buckets to glacier-tier after 180 days of inactivity. Support should never trigger a run manually without confirming the retention ledger is current, since deletions are irreversible after the grace window. Deploys go through the Bramleigh pipeline, one region at a time. Each region's deploy reads the configuration values below.

deployment values, kajep-kageg:
[praix]
host = praix.paliqcorp.corp
user = praix_svc
database = praix_prod